摘要

A fuzzy-integral model of an extremal fuzzy process (EFP) is considered. The model describes the evolution of one class of weakly structurable fuzzy dynamic systems (Klir 1985), i.e. of the so-called extremal fuzzy dynamic systems, which have been constructed in Part Ⅲ of this work. In the present paper, problems of an optimal filtering of continuous as well as of discrete EFP are solved by means of "past" evaluating information. Sufficient conditions are established for the existence of an optimal estimating fuzzy process. Using only one "past" evaluating fuzzy state of the considered system, variants of fuzzy observers (representations of an optimal estimating EFP) are constructed in terms of approximation of piecewise-constant and extremally measurable filtration functions for continuous and discrete extremal fuzzy dynamic systems. The results obtained are illustrated by a numerical example.
